Stephan Metz is a scholar working on Radiology, Nuclear Medicine and Imaging, Biomedical Engineering and Molecular Biology. According to data from OpenAlex, Stephan Metz has authored 30 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Radiology, Nuclear Medicine and Imaging, 8 papers in Biomedical Engineering and 7 papers in Molecular Biology. Recurrent topics in Stephan Metz’s work include MRI in cancer diagnosis (6 papers), Advanced MRI Techniques and Applications (5 papers) and Radiomics and Machine Learning in Medical Imaging (4 papers). Stephan Metz is often cited by papers focused on MRI in cancer diagnosis (6 papers), Advanced MRI Techniques and Applications (5 papers) and Radiomics and Machine Learning in Medical Imaging (4 papers). Stephan Metz collaborates with scholars based in Germany, United States and Finland. Stephan Metz's co-authors include Ernst J. Rummeny, Heike E. Daldrup‐Link, Marcus Settles, Ambros J. Beer, Gabriel A. Bonaterra, Martina Rudelius, Jürgen Schlegel, Guido Piontek, Reinhard Meier and Markus Schwaiger and has published in prestigious journals such as Circulation, PLoS ONE and Clinical Cancer Research.
